7shifts is a workforce management software platform designed specifically for restaurants to streamline employee scheduling, time tracking, and team communication through a centralized system. This restaurant management software enables managers to create staff schedules, track labor costs, and monitor employee availability while improving operational efficiency. Deputy is a workforce management and employee scheduling platform designed to help businesses manage shift based teams, track employee time, and streamline payroll related tasks. Google Workspace, formerly known as G Suite, is a collection of cloud-based productivity and collaboration tools developed by Google. It includes popular applications such as Gmail for email, Google Drive for storage, Google Docs, Sheets, and Slides for document creation and editing, and Google Calendar for scheduling. Paycor is a comprehensive human capital management (HCM) solution designed for small and medium-sized businesses. Simplifying HR tasks, Paycor offers features like payroll processing, time and attendance tracking, and benefits administration.
